The Passing Of Frank Frazetta
« on: May 11, 2010, 08:25:10 AM »
Frank Frazetta was the name in fantasy art, creating images of heroic warriors, beautiful women, & fearsome monsters.

His work appeared in comics, such as Creepy, and  on the cover of books & magazines.
He died Monday 05/11/10, of a stroke.
The New York Times referred to his work as "the last gasp of Classicism", and they darn well meant it as a compliment.
One of the greats is gone.
